Reseña del editor:
Reinforce learning decimals at home with 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als, a workbook that supports school curriculum and classroom teaching on decimals by adding quick but valuable practice time for adding, subtracting, multiplying, and dividing decimal numbers. 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als utilizes a proven learning strategy for learning decimals.

Encourage your child's learning with the effective "little and often" learning strategy outlined in 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als. Proven effective, this leveled, curriculum-supporting method is great for children who resist long periods of study, or for children who need focused attention in decimals. 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als is different than other study books because it includes an embedded LCD timer that encourages children to beat the clock, adding an extra element of challenge to focused study time.

The 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als workbook is broken into study challenges and exercises designed to take up to 10 minutes to complete. Children work through a series of quick-answer decimal questions, then move onto extension activities and timed exercises if they have time left after the first round of study questions. The timer acts as a stopwatch for skills challenges, and many kids are surprised to find that beating the timer can actually be fun.

10 Minutes a Day: Decimals helps children learn by supplementing school curriculum and strengthening the important skill of learning decimals. Parents will love that 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als helps them fit short bursts of study into already busy days, and that 10 Minutes a Day: Decimals includes an answer key for parents, as well as notes on common pitfalls and how to teach children to overcome them.

Biografía del autor:
DK was founded in London in 1974 and is now the world's leading illustrated reference publisher and part of Penguin Random House, formed on July 1, 2013. DK publishes highly visual, photographic nonfiction for adults and children. DK produces content for consumers in over 87 countries and in 62 languages, with offices in Delhi, London, Melbourne, Munich, New York, and Toronto. DK's aim is to inform, enrich, and entertain readers of all ages, and everything DK publishes, whether print or digital, embodies the unique DK design approach. DK brings unrivalled clarity to a wide range of topics with a unique combination of words and pictures, put together to spectacular effect. We have a reputation for innovation in design for both print and digital products.   Our adult range spans travel, including the award-winning DK Eyewitness Travel Guides, history, science, nature, sport, gardening, cookery, and parenting. DK’s extensive children’s list showcases a fantastic store of information for children, toddlers, and babies. DK covers everything from animals and the human body, to homework help and craft activities, together with an impressive list of licensing titles, including the bestselling LEGO® books. DK acts as the parent company for Alpha Books, publisher of the Idiot's Guides series and Prima Games, video gaming publishers, as well as the award-winning travel publisher, Rough Guides.
